User input: $ARGUMENTS ## Overview Perform structured code review of completed implementation work, validate against specifications, and update task status in tasks.md. ## Steps ### 1. Load Context Run script to get feature paths and information: ```bash cd "$(git rev-parse --show-toplevel)" && \ source .specify/scripts/bash/common.sh && \ get_feature_paths ``` This provides: - `FEATURE_DIR` - Feature directory path - `FEATURE_SPEC` - Specification file (spec.md) - `IMPL_PLAN` - Implementation plan (plan.md) - `TASKS` - Task list (tasks.md) Load these files to understand: - Feature requirements and acceptance criteria - Implementation approach and design decisions - Task breakdown and current status ### 2. Identify Review Target **If user provided task ID** (e.g., "T001" in arguments): - Review that specific task - Focus review on changes related to that task **If no task ID provided**: - Review all pending tasks (marked with `[ ]` in tasks.md) - Or review most recent code changes - Ask user which tasks to review if unclear ### 3. Review Implementation Conduct thorough review: **A. Load Code Changes** ```bash # Show recent changes git diff main..HEAD # Or show diff for specific files git diff main..HEAD -- path/to/file ``` **B. Verify Against Specification** - Check if implementation meets acceptance criteria in spec.md - Verify design decisions from plan.md are followed - Ensure behavior matches expected outcomes **C. Check Code Quality** - Look for bugs, edge cases, error handling - Check code clarity and maintainability - Verify proper testing coverage - Check documentation completeness - Flag placeholder/TODO/FIXME code within the implementation scope **D. Run Tests** (if available) ```bash # Run test suite based on project structure npm test # Node.js projects pytest # Python projects cargo test # Rust projects go test ./... # Go projects ./gradlew test # Java/Kotlin projects ``` **E. Validate Against Quality Gates** - Code follows project standards - Tests exist and pass - Edge cases handled - Documentation adequate - No obvious security issues - No placeholder/TODO/FIXME code left in reviewed scope unless justified and tracked ### 4. Determine Review Outcome Choose one of three outcomes: **Approved - Implementation Ready** Criteria: - All acceptance criteria met - All tests passing - No blocking issues found - Code quality acceptable - Ready to merge **Approved with Minor Notes** Criteria: - Core functionality works correctly - Tests passing - Minor improvements suggested (not blocking) - Can be addressed in follow-up - OK to merge with notes **Needs Changes - Issues Must Be Fixed** Criteria: - Bugs or regressions found - Tests failing or missing - Acceptance criteria not met - Security or critical issues - Must fix before approval ### 5. Update Tasks (For Approved Work Only) For approved work, mark completed tasks as done: ```bash # Mark specific task as done .specify/extensions/workflows/scripts/bash/mark-task-status.sh --task-id T001 --status done # Mark multiple tasks .specify/extensions/workflows/scripts/bash/mark-task-status.sh --task-id T002 --status done .specify/extensions/workflows/scripts/bash/mark-task-status.sh --task-id T003 --status done ``` This updates tasks.md, changing: - `[ ] T001: Task description` -> `[X] T001: Task description` **For "Needs Changes" outcome**: Do NOT mark tasks as done. They remain pending until issues are fixed. ### 6.
